郑州在线教育小程序开发
随着互联网技术的不断进步,在线教育逐渐成为学习的重要方式之一。郑州作为中原地区的重要城市,在线教育的发展也受到越来越多关注。小程序作为一种轻量级应用,为用户提供了便捷的学习途径。以下将围绕郑州在线教育小程序的开发,从多个方面进行说明。 一、在线教育小程序的基本概念 在线教育小程序是指通过小程序平台提供的教育类应用,用户无需下载安装即可使用。这类小程序通常包含课程展示、学习资料、互动功能等模块,旨在为用户提供灵活的学习体验。在郑州,许多教育机构和个人开发者开始关注小程序的开发,以满足本地学习者的...
随着互联网技术的不断进步,在线教育逐渐成为学习的重要方式之一。郑州作为中原地区的重要城市,在线教育的发展也受到越来越多关注。小程序作为一种轻量级应用,为用户提供了便捷的学习途径。以下将围绕郑州在线教育小程序的开发,从多个方面进行说明。
一、在线教育小程序的基本概念
在线教育小程序是指通过小程序平台提供的教育类应用,用户无需下载安装即可使用。这类小程序通常包含课程展示、学习资料、互动功能等模块,旨在为用户提供灵活的学习体验。在郑州,许多教育机构和个人开发者开始关注小程序的开发,以满足本地学习者的需求。
二、开发在线教育小程序的意义
开发在线教育小程序有助于扩大教育资源的覆盖范围。学习者可以通过手机随时访问课程内容,不受时间和地点限制。对于教育机构而言,小程序可以降低运营成本,提高教学效率。小程序还能提供个性化的学习推荐,帮助用户更高效地安排学习计划。
三、开发流程概述
开发一个在线教育小程序通常包括需求分析、设计、开发、测试和上线等阶段。在需求分析阶段,开发者需要明确目标用户和功能需求,例如课程管理、用户交互、支付系统等。设计阶段涉及界面和用户体验的规划,确保小程序易于使用。开发阶段则包括前端和后端的编码工作,测试阶段需检查功能是否正常,最终上线后需持续维护和更新。
四、功能模块介绍
在线教育小程序常见的功能模块包括:
1.课程展示:展示available的课程列表,包括课程名称、简介、价格等信息。
2.用户注册与登录:允许用户创建账户并登录,以保存学习进度和个人信息。
3.学习记录:记录用户的学习历史和进度,方便继续学习。
4.互动功能:如评论、问答或直播互动,增强学习体验。
5.支付系统:支持用户通过小程序购买课程,使用元进行交易。
这些功能可以根据具体需求进行调整和扩展。
五、技术实现要点
在技术层面,开发在线教育小程序需要考虑前端和后端的协调。前端通常使用小程序框架进行开发,确保界面响应迅速。后端则负责数据处理和存储,例如用户信息、课程内容等。数据库的设计应保证数据的安全性和可靠性。集成第三方服务如支付接口时,需遵循相关规范。
六、用户体验设计
用户体验是在线教育小程序成功的关键因素。设计时应注重界面简洁明了,操作流程顺畅。例如,课程分类清晰,搜索功能便捷,学习路径直观。避免过多复杂元素,确保用户能快速找到所需内容。适配不同设备屏幕大小,提升访问舒适度。
七、维护与更新
小程序上线后,定期维护是必要的。这包括修复可能出现的错误、更新课程内容、优化性能等。通过用户反馈收集建议,不断改进功能。维护工作有助于保持小程序的稳定性和用户满意度。
八、潜在挑战与应对
开发在线教育小程序可能面临一些挑战,例如技术复杂度、市场竞争等。应对方法包括加强团队技术培训、进行市场调研以了解用户需求、注重内容质量提升吸引力。遵守相关法律法规,确保数据隐私和安全。
九、总结
郑州在线教育小程序的开发是一个多方面的过程,涉及需求分析、设计、技术实现和维护等环节。通过合理规划和完善功能,可以为学习者提供有价值的工具。未来,随着技术发展,在线教育小程序有望继续演进,更好地服务于教育领域。
在线教育小程序的开发需要综合考虑功能、技术和用户体验,以实现其教育目的。在郑州这样的城市,这类应用有望为本地教育生态带来积极影响。


